Chapter 27: Seeking Refuge from the Trials of This World - كتاب الاستعاذة

أَخْبَرَنَا أَحْمَدُ بْنُ فَضَالَةَ، عَنْ عُبَيْدِ اللَّهِ، قَالَ أَنْبَأَنَا إِسْرَائِيلُ، عَنْ أَبِي إِسْحَاقَ، عَنْ عَمْرِو بْنِ مَيْمُونٍ، عَنْ عُمَرَ، أَنَّ النَّبِيَّ صلى الله عليه وسلم كَانَ يَتَعَوَّذُ مِنَ الْجُبْنِ وَالْبُخْلِ وَسُوءِ الْعُمُرِ وَفِتْنَةِ الصَّدْرِ وَعَذَابِ الْقَبْرِ ‏.‏

It was narrated from 'Umar that:

The Prophet [SAW] used to seek refuge with Allah from cowardice, miserliness, reaching the age of second childhood, the trials of the heart and the torment of the grave.

In-book reference : Book 50, Hadith 53
